Transaction 5859bd79605da8f355c2e1d655667797c6a6a8070f2a778c5780481130163cca

1 Input
2 Outputs
  • 5859bd79605da8f355c2e1d655667797c6a6a8070f2a778c5780481130163cca:0
  • value  7280000
    address  3FzpNmAd93ZgyLdCSacjLgFQ3tyabS66st
  • 5859bd79605da8f355c2e1d655667797c6a6a8070f2a778c5780481130163cca:1
  • value  66644666
    address  1CFQDbASeDMqnpsQ5dAJMkT2wg6X27KtPU